Going … WebThe National Runners and Walkers Health Study in 2013, analyzing over 89000 runners, including marathon runners, showed that running does not increase the risk of osteoarthritis. This study also showed that running decreases the risk of osteoarthritis, and hip replacement, due to the lower body mass index (BMI) of the running population.

Elevate … WebJan 25, 2024 · Shin splints, like runner's knee, is a term that describes a set of symptoms, not an actual diagnosis. Shin splint pain most commonly refers to inflammation of the attachment of the leg muscles to the shin bone.
